regarding ur questions, it all depends on ur taste actually. some poeple can afford to go to all the hot shot garages in sunway, some prefer a more moddest bengkel..i myself go to UMS in puchong. had my rb26 rebuild there the price is very reasonable n excellent workmanship. but its not the type of garage where theres tons of performance parts. but the mech ( Akentaro, who THINKS he is japanese) does only rb's n sr. so he is quite good with skylines.

for my point of view, the gtt brakes are quite good but depends on ur style of driving n braking. if ur the type who likes to drive in fast into a corner n do the last braking then prefered ur change to better disc as the ori disc will warp soon.. a set of aftermarket disc n performance pads would be adequate for street use..
